**Ticket: Config drift on Wrenlet gateway (ws compression)**

Heads up for the sync: staging and prod have drifted again on the Wrenlet websocket tier. Someone bumped permessage-deflate window bits on prod during the Kelbourne incident and never backported it. Bigger windows cut bandwidth ~18% but memory per connection roughly doubled, which is why the pods started OOMing. We should pick one setting and stick with it. For reference, prod is currently running with the following.

service settings:
[casax]
port = 6379
team = rusir
host = casax.zemvarhq.corp
region = outer-4
access_code = ac_9808ce
timeout_ms = 1500

Ticket: Config drift — Fanlark notification fan-out

Production Fanlark nodes diverged from the repo baseline. Backpressure thresholds were hand-edited during the Stagmere incident and never committed, so two nodes shed load at different queue depths, causing uneven delivery latency. Please review the attached diff restoring uniform settings; the incident values are intentionally kept for the burst window only. For comparison, production currently runs with the following values.

settings of tagef-bawif:
DRUIX_HOST=druix.zemvarlabs.internal
DRUIX_PORT=8000

### Runbook: BounceBroom — Account Recovery

If the BounceBroom email bounce processor loses access to its service account, do not create a new one. First, pause the intake queue so bounces buffer safely. Then open the recovery console and select the BounceBroom principal. Verification requires approval from the on-call lead. Once approved, the console prompts for the stored recovery credentials; enter the passphrase that appears directly below this paragraph.

recovery phrase for fahof-kahap: holion-gormir-jorix-istix-briwyn-sorael